Competing in the compact SUV, the 2010 Mercury Mariner goes up against other notable names in the class, like the 2010 Chevrolet Equinox, the 2010 Honda CR-V, and the 2010 Mitsubishi Outlander. Spread across 2 trims, the Mariner starts off at a base price of MSRP $23,560 and carries on to $27,380. Not all trims are built equal, however, as there are 2 powertrains on offer. The standard engine is a 2.5L Inline-4 rated for 171 horsepower and 171 lb-ft of torque. With this engine, the Mariner gives you a towing capacity of 3500 pounds. An optional 3.0L V6 is also offered, with an output of 240 horsepower. A 6-speed automatic is offered alongside both engines. When buying a 2010 Mariner, one can expect an average price of $7206. The interior of the 2010 Mariner is well-designed and features comfortable seating for up to five passengers. The materials are of good quality, and the overall layout is intuitive and user-friendly. The cargo area is also quite spacious, offering 29.2 cubic feet of space behind the rear seats, which can be expanded to 72.8 cubic feet with the rear seats folded down.

Whereas, the exterior of the 2010 Mariner is sleek and modern, with a bold front grille, wraparound headlights, and a distinctive rear spoiler. The overall design is attractive and attractive, making the Mariner stand out in a crowded compact SUV market.

Safety is also a strong point for the 2010 Mariner, with standard features such as stability control, traction control, and a full complement of airbags. The Mariner also earned good crash test ratings from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A).

In conclusion, the 2010 Mercury Mariner SUV is a solid choice for buyers looking for a compact crossover with good fuel economy, a comfortable interior, and a spacious cargo area. It offers a comfortable and stable ride, with precise handling and responsive acceleration. The overall design is attractive and modern, and the Mariner is a strong contender in its class.
